Hearty Beef and Vegetable Stew

hearty beef vegetable stew

Hearty Beef and Vegetable Stew is a warm and comforting dish perfect for fall evenings. Made in a crockpot, this stew combines tender chunks of beef with a variety of colorful vegetables, guaranteeing a nutritious and satisfying meal. The slow cooking process allows the flavors to meld beautifully, making it an ideal dinner for busy weeknights.

Ingredients Quantity
Beef chuck, cut into cubes 2 pounds
Carrots, sliced 3 large
Potatoes, cubed 4 medium
Celery, chopped 2 stalks
Onion, chopped 1 large
Garlic, minced 4 cloves
Beef broth 4 cups
Tomato paste 2 tablespoons
Worcestershire sauce 2 tablespoons
Dried thyme 1 teaspoon
Dried rosemary 1 teaspo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ste
Bay leaves 2

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In the crockpot, combine all the ingredients: beef, carrots, potatoes, celery, onion, garlic, beef broth, tomato paste, Worcestershire sauce, thyme, rosemary, salt, pepper, and bay leaves.
  2. Stir to combine and guarantee the beef and vegetables are well coated with the liquids and seasonings.
  3. Cover and cook on low for 7-8 hours or on high for 4-5 hours, until the beef is tender and the vegetables are cooked through.
  4. Remove bay leaves before serving.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Serve hot.

Creamy Tuscan Chicken

creamy tuscan chicken recipe

Creamy Tuscan Chicken is a deliciously rich and comforting dish that combines succulent chicken breasts with a creamy sauce enriched with sun-dried tomatoes, spinach, and Italian herbs. Perfectly cooked in a crockpot, this dish allows the flavors to meld together beautifully, resulting in a hearty meal that’s ideal for cool fall evenings.

Ingredients Quantity
Chicken breasts, boneless 2 pounds
Sun-dried tomatoes, chopped ½ cup
Fresh spinach, chopped 4 cups
Heavy cream 1 cup
Chicken broth 1 cup
Garlic, minced 4 cloves
Italian seasoning 2 teaspoons
Parmesan cheese, grated ½ cup
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Sear the chicken breasts for 2-3 minutes on each side until golden brown. Remove and place in the crockpot.
  2. In the same skillet, add garlic, sun-dried tomatoes, and spinach, cooking until the spinach wilts. Stir in chicken broth and heavy cream, then bring to a simmer.
  3. Pour the creamy mixture over the chicken in the crockpot. Sprinkle with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 4-6 hours or on high for 2-3 hours. Add grated Parmesan during the last 30 minutes of cooking.
  5. Serve hot, garnished with additional Parmesan if desired.

Pumpkin Chili

hearty pumpkin chili recipe

Pumpkin Chili is a hearty and warming dish that brilliantly combines the earthy flavors of pumpkin with classic chili spices, making it an ideal comfort food for fall. This crockpot recipe is not only simple but also offers a healthy twist by incorporating beans and vegetables, ensuring a deliciously filling meal for chilly evenings.

Ingredients Quantity
Ground beef or turkey 1 pound
Pumpkin puree 1 can (15 oz)
Kidney beans, drained 1 can (15 oz)
Black beans, drained 1 can (15 oz)
Diced tomatoes 1 can (14.5 oz)
Onion, chopped 1 medium
Bell pepper, chopped 1 medium
Garlic, minced 3 cloves
Chili powder 2 tablespoons
Cumin 1 tablespo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ste
Olive oil 1 tablespoon
Vegetable broth 1 cup

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at and sauté the onion, bell pepper, and garlic until softened. Add the ground beef or turkey and cook until browned. Drain excess fat if necessary.
  2. Transfer the meat mixture to the crockpot. Add pumpkin puree, kidney beans, black beans, diced tomatoes, chili powder, cumin, salt, and black pepper. Stir well to combine.
  3. Pour in vegetable broth and stir again, ensuring all ingredients are mixed.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ours.
  5. Serve hot, garnished with your choice of toppings such as sour cream or cheese if desired.

Maple Glazed Pork Tenderloin

maple glazed pork tenderloin

Maple Glazed Pork Tenderloin is a delicious and comforting dish that perfectly captures the essence of fall flavors. This sweet and savory meal features succulent pork tenderloin slow-cooked in a rich maple syrup glaze, creating an irresistible aroma that will fill your kitchen. It pairs wonderfully with seasonal vegetables for a wholesome dinner.

Ingredients Quantity
Pork tenderloin 1.5 pounds
Maple syrup 1/2 cup
Dijon mustard 2 tablespoons
Soy sauce 2 tablespoons
Garlic, minced 3 cloves
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ste
Thyme, dried 1 teaspoon
Olive oil 1 tablespoon
Apples, sliced 2 medium
Onion, sliced 1 medium

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In a bowl, mix together maple syrup, Dijon mustard, soy sauce, minced garlic, salt, black pepper, and thyme to create the glaze.
  2. In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at and sear the pork tenderloin on all sides until browned.
  3. Transfer the seared pork to the crockpot. Pour the maple glaze over the meat, then add sliced apples and onions.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-7 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the pork is tender and fully cooked.
  5. Serve slices of the pork drizzled with the remaining glaze and accompanied by the cooked apples and onions.

Lentil and Sweet Potato Curry

hearty lentil sweet potato curry

Lentil and Sweet Potato Curry is a vibrant and hearty dish that encapsulates the warm, comforting flavors of fall. This vegetarian curry is packed with nutritious ingredients, featuring protein-rich lentils and sweet potatoes simmered in a fragrant blend of spices and coconut milk. It’s perfect for a cozy dinner in your crockpot, leaving you with a delicious meal and minimal cleanup.

Ingredients Quantity
Green or brown lentils 1 cup
Sweet potatoes, diced 2 medium
Onion, chopped 1 medium
Garlic, minced 3 cloves
Ginger, grated 1 tablespoon
Coconut milk 1 can (14 oz)
Vegetable broth 3 cups
Diced tomatoes (canned) 1 can (14 oz)
Curry powder 2 tablespoons
Turmeric 1 teaspoon
Cumin 1 teaspoon
Spinach 2 cups (fresh)
Olive oil 1 tablespo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at and sauté the chopped onion, garlic, and ginger until softened.
  2. Add curry powder, turmeric, and cumin to the onion mixture and cook for another minute until fragrant.
  3. Transfer the sautéed mixture to the crockpot along with lentils, diced sweet potatoes, coconut milk, vegetable broth, and diced tomatoes. Season with salt and black pepper.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the lentils and sweet potatoes are tender.
  5. Stir in fresh spinach before serving, allowing it to wilt. Serve warm and enjoy!

Classic Chicken Noodle Soup

comforting chicken noodle soup

Classic Chicken Noodle Soup is a timeless comfort dish, perfect for cool fall evenings. This hearty and flavorful soup features tender chicken, egg noodles, and a colorful medley of vegetables simmered in a savory broth. It’s an ideal recipe for crockpot cooking, allowing all the flavors to meld beautifully over several hours while you enjoy the comforting aroma wafting through your home.

Ingredients Quantity
Chicken breast, diced 2 cups
Egg noodles 2 cups
Carrots, sliced 2 medium
Celery, sliced 2 stalks
Onion, chopped 1 medium
Garlic, minced 2 cloves
Chicken broth 6 cups
Bay leaves 2
Thyme 1 teaspo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ste
Parsley, chopped 1/4 cup

Cooking Instructions:

  1. Add the diced chicken, carrots, celery, onion, garlic, chicken broth, bay leaves, thyme, salt, and black pepper to the crockpot.
  2. Cover and cook on low for 6-7 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until chicken is fully cooked and vegetables are tender.
  3. About 30 minutes before serving, stir in the egg noodles and continue cooking until they are tender.
  4. Remove bay leaves, stir in chopped parsley, and serve warm. Enjoy!

Cheesy Potato and Sausage Casserole

warm cheesy potato casserole

Cheesy Potato and Sausage Casserole is a warm, hearty dish that brings together the comforting flavors of creamy potatoes, savory sausage, and melted cheese. Ideal for chilly fall evenings, this crockpot recipe allows the ingredients to blend beautifully, resulting in a satisfying meal with minimal effort. Simply add your ingredients to the crockpot and let it do the work while you enjoy the delightful aromas filling your home.

Ingredients Quantity
Potatoes, diced 4 cups
Smoked sausage, sliced 1 pound
Onion, chopped 1 medium
Cheddar cheese, shredded 2 cups
Cream of mushroom soup 2 cans (10.5 oz each)
Garlic powder 1 teaspo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ste
Green onions, chopped 1/4 cup

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In the crockpot, combine the diced potatoes, sliced sausage, chopped onion, and garlic powder. Season with salt and black pepper.
  2. Pour the cream of mushroom soup over the top and mix to combine.
  3. Cover and cook on low for 7-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the potatoes are tender.
  4. About 15 minutes before serving, stir in the shredded cheddar cheese until melted.
  5. Serve hot, garnished with chopped green onions. Enjoy!

Rustic Vegetable and Barley Soup

hearty vegetable barley soup

Rustic Vegetable and Barley Soup is a warming, nutritious dish perfect for fall. This hearty soup is brimming with colorful vegetables and nutty barley, making it a wholesome, filling option for those crisp evenings. The slow-cooked flavors come together beautifully, and the crockpot allows for easy preparation, letting you enjoy the cozy aroma wafting through your home while it simmers.

Ingredients Quantity
Barley, uncooked 1 cup
Carrots, diced 2 large
Celery, chopped 2 stalks
Potatoes, diced 2 medium
Onion, chopped 1 medium
Garlic, minced 3 cloves
Vegetable broth 8 cups
Canned diced tomatoes 1 can (15 oz)
Spinach or kale, chopped 2 cups
Italian seasoning 1 tablespo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In the crockpot, combine the barley, diced carrots, chopped celery, diced potatoes, chopped onion, minced garlic, vegetable broth, and diced tomatoes.
  2. Add Italian seasoning, salt, and black pepper; stir to mix.
  3.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the barley and vegetables are tender.
  4. About 15 minutes before serving, stir in the chopped spinach or kale and allow it to wilt.
  5. Adjust seasoning as needed, serve hot, and enjoy!

Honey Garlic Chicken Thighs

honey garlic chicken thighs

Honey Garlic Chicken Thighs are a flavorful and satisfying dish that’s perfect for a cozy fall dinner. The combination of sweet honey and savory garlic creates a sticky glaze that beautifully coats tender, juicy chicken thighs. Cooking them in the crockpot allows the flavors to develop fully while keeping the chicken moist and delicious, making it a hassle-free meal option for busy evenings.

Ingredients Quantity
Chicken thighs, bone-in, skin-on 4-6 pieces
Honey 1/2 cup
Soy sauce 1/4 cup
Garlic, minced 4 cloves
Ginger, grated 1 teaspoon
Olive oil 1 tablespoon
Apple cider vinegar 1 tablespoon
Pepper flakes (optional) 1/2 teaspoon
Salt To taste
Green onions, chopped For garnish

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In a bowl, whisk together honey, soy sauce, minced garlic, grated ginger, olive oil, apple cider vinegar, and optional pepper flakes.
  2. Place the chicken thighs in the crockpot and season lightly with salt. Pour the honey-garlic mixture over the chicken, ensuring it’s well-coated.
  3.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the chicken is tender and cooked through.
  4. Before serving, garnish with chopped green onions and drizzle some of the sauce from the crockpot over the chicken for extra flavor. Serve hot and enjoy!

Spaghetti Squash and Meatballs

crockpot spaghetti squash meatballs

Spaghetti Squash and Meatballs is a healthy and hearty dish that combines the nutty flavor of roasted spaghetti squash with savory, homemade meatballs. This comforting meal is perfect for chilly fall evenings, offering a delicious alternative to traditional pasta. Cooking it all in the crockpot not only enhances the flavors but also makes prep and clean-up a breeze, allowing you to enjoy a delightful dinner with minimal effort.

Ingredients Quantity
Spaghetti squash 1 medium
Ground beef (or turkey) 1 pound
Breadcrumbs 1/2 cup
Parmesan cheese, grated 1/4 cup
Egg 1 large
Garlic powder 1 teaspoon
Italian seasoning 1 teaspo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ste
Marinara sauce 2 cups
Fresh basil, chopped (for garnish) For garnish

Cooking Instructions:

  1. Cut the spaghetti squash in half lengthwise and scoop out the seeds. Season with salt and pepper, then place cut-side down in the crockpot.
  2. In a bowl, mix together ground beef, bre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, egg, garlic powder, Italian seasoning, salt, and black pepper. Form into meatballs.
  3. Place the meatballs in the crockpot around the spaghetti squash. Pour marinara sauce over the meatballs and squash.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-7 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the meatballs are cooked through and the squash is tender.
  5. When ready to serve, carefully scoop the spaghetti squash strands from the skin and combine with the meatballs and sauce. Garnish with fresh basil and enjoy!

Apple Crisp Oatmeal

cozy crockpot apple oatmeal

Apple Crisp Oatmeal is a warm and comforting breakfast that combines the flavors of sweet, cinnamon-spiced apples with hearty oats, creating a cozy way to start your fall mornings. Made easy in the crockpot, this dish simmers together overnight or during the day,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ully while you go about your day.

Ingredients Quantity
Old-fashioned rolled oats 2 cups
Apples, peeled and diced 4 medium
Brown sugar 1/2 cup
Ground cinnamon 1 tablespoon
Ground nutmeg 1/2 teaspoon
Vanilla extract 1 teaspoon
Milk (or almond milk) 4 cups
Salt 1/2 teaspoon
Chopped walnuts (for topping) 1/2 cup

Cooking Instructions:

  1. In the crockpot, combine rolled oats, diced apples, brown sugar, cinnamon, nutmeg, vanilla, milk, and salt. Stir to mix well.
  2.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ours, or on high for 3-4 hours, until the oats are creamy and the apples are tender.
  3. Serve warm, topped with chopped walnuts and a drizzle of additional brown sugar or maple syrup if desired. Enjoy!
